Often various members of my local LUG get together and combine orders from a
store under one user. It would be nice to be able to split an order up after
submission to easily so who owes what.

Seller would not need to know or be impacted by the feature.

Each member could place their order in one unique batch and see if the seller
can fill and bag by batch (best to ask 1st). A bigger order might be worth a
little extra effort from a seller. I know that I would do it if asked.

I don't think there's enough demand for this feature to utilize resources
when much more important things are needed. Voted no.

We already separate batches into separate baggies in our store. Each individual
piece is bagged and labeled with part number, color, and quantity. Then each
lot of bagged pieces are put together in one baggie. So if there are three lots,
three baggies of individually bagged parts. We just figured it would be easier
for the seller to go through the order to make sure everything is there.

Heck, if you'd leave us a note with the name of each individual, we'd
even label the lot bags so you'd know who got what!
